Transaction d2583f47e684910fbcce99438bf4c398606ab3888715048a1916baed955fb039

1 Input
1 Outputs
  • d2583f47e684910fbcce99438bf4c398606ab3888715048a1916baed955fb039:0
  • value  3482
    address  3QMfm5hJSb792gpCGyBgkNuLxYahEvNFNV